The Football Association of Thailand (FAT) and the new national coach Peter Reid will sign a four-year contract today at the Radisson hotel at 2pm.
The former Everton and England international arrived in Bangkok last week and has already got down to work.
Chief of the FAT Worawi Makudi said Reid watched matches in the Thailand Premier League last weekend.
The FAT has also prepared a video of the Thai team during the World Cup qualifying round.
''It will give him an idea of how the Thai team plays,'' said Worawi.
''If he needs anything else, we will arrange it. He has full authority as national coach.''
Worawi confirmed the contract would be for four years.
Concerning the staff coaches, Worawi said he hoped former national mid-fielder Surachai Jaturapattarapong, who is now the staff coach for Home United in the S-League in Singapore, would be available. However, he was not sure if he could leave the Singapore club immediately.
Another staff coach is expected to be former captain Tawan Sripan.
